What an MLOps Engineer Actually Does — The Role Most Don't Know Exists

The job of an MLOps engineer consists of ensuring reliable performance of machine learning algorithms in non-development environments. The data scientist could build and test the algorithm, yet someone needs to package it, launch in a real environment, monitor performance, version control the data and the model itself, automate the workflow, and ensure that the application can support real users. And here we go – MLOps. This profession involves combining software engineering skills, cloud infrastructure knowledge, machine learning, automation techniques, and DevOps with AI into the consistent workflow.

It gets even more important as soon as an organization starts to have several algorithms operating simultaneously. Today everything can work perfectly fine, yet tomorrow the incoming data can change behavior of the algorithm completely. It means that the production system should be constantly monitored and maintained, and an MLOps engineer can help to set up the pipeline for this process. Machine learning algorithms are not considered as the projects anymore – they become the systems.

Core Skills Every MLOps Engineer Must Build in 2026

In order to become an effective mlops engineer, you need to have a solid background in the areas of development, infrastructure, machine learning, and automation. You can get all the required skills in an mlops certification course, but practical experience is also vital. You will learn how to connect the components of the machine learning lifecycle and how to solve issues that arise during production. The set of necessary skills includes:

•                 Python and programming – creating automation scripts, services, and machine learning workflows.

•                 Containers – working with Docker and containerized machine learning applications.

•                 Kubernetes – managing and scaling containerized workloads.

•                 Cloud – understanding cloud storage, cloud compute, cloud network, cloud security, and managed ML services.

•                 ML pipelines – automating ML processes like data preparation, training, testing, and deployment.

•                 Monitoring – tracking the performance of ML models, monitoring the state of infrastructure, data and production issues.

•                 Generative AI – understanding how to incorporate modern AI applications into production pipelines.

As we can see from the list above, each skill is important by itself, but they should be learned and applied together. For instance, Docker skills can be very useful, but having knowledge of how to pack an ML model, how to deploy it using a pipeline, to monitor it and how to update it on the fly is much more useful in practice.

Career Opportunities and Salary After an MLOps Engineer Course

The completion of a mlops course with placement opens up possibilities in several tech teams since MLOps integrates machine learning and production engineering. Based on your past experience, you can aim for positions such as MLOps Engineer, Machine Learning Platform Engineer, ML Infrastructure Engineer, AI DevOps Engineer, and Cloud MLOps Engineer. The name of the job position will vary based on the employer and the tech stack they use, but the key thing that will always remain common is taking the machine learning system from experimental to reliable operations.
